Very typical syrah, blueberry, pepper, violet, this being juicy and fruit forward in Gonon style, but starting to develop some earthy notes, some bacon, I think I liked this even better a little younger, drink up!

Good God Gonon. Poured blind to me. I guessed it as top flight Cornas. What a wine. Pure Rhône Valley blood. Pure tight fruit and structure and perfect balance. And this wine is Ardeche! I used to sell Gonon. If I still did I would keep every bottle for myself. Now I have to taste some recent St Joseph. Drink. You could hold it but man when it’s this good it’s hard not to drink.

La maison Pierre Gonon disfruta de una merecida reputación por su trabajo en la zona del Ródano. En este caso trabaja con viñas jóvenes en las laderas de Tournon y St. Jean de Muzols y viñas de unos 30 años en las parcelas más bajas de Saint-Joseph. Atractiva syrah de perfil muy franco, con un color granate vivo de buena capa y una nariz atractiva, muy bien definida con seductores notas de violetas, toques aceitunas negras, suaves especiados y matices tostados. En boca entra bien, con cuerpo medio, tanino firme, buena acidez, suaves amargos, estructura media y bastante persistencia. Una buena aproximación a la syrah.

Gorgeous nose of violets, pepper, olives. Lively, juicy fruit on the palate, good acidity and freshness. Spicy with marks of pepper and dark olives, this is a great vintage of this wine. Will it get better? I don’t think so. Will it age well? Yes, I think so. But I would drink this now for the sheer pleasure of the fruit and the aromatics and then wait for the St-Jo.

Coming into its own. A bit astringent on opening but really blossoms with a couple hours air. Meat, olives, and sweet Gonon fruit. Hard to put down.
